Srinagar, June 2: Union Minister of Fisheries, Animal Husbandry and Dairying Parshottam Rupala Friday stated that the Animal Husbandry Department has to make deliberate efforts to extend availability and accessibility of higher veterinary well being providers to minimise financial losses as a consequence of animal ailments.

An official spokesman in a press release issued right here stated that chairing the inter-session assembly of the Consultative Committee connected to his ministry in Srinagar, Rupala stated that India had an unlimited useful resource of livestock and poultry, which performs an important position in bettering the socio-economic circumstances of rural lots.

Minister of State (MoS) Fisheries, Animal Husbandry and Dairying–I, Sanjeev Kumar Baliyan, Minister of State (MoS) Fisheries, Animal Husbandry and Dairying–II, L Murugan, Members of Parliament, and members of the Parliament Consultative Committee additionally attended the assembly.

The committee deliberated on numerous features of ‘strengthening of veterinary services through mobile units and implementation of vaccination programmes in the country’.

The Members of Parliament appreciated the efforts being taken by the division, particularly for the Mobile Veterinary Units (MVUs) with one hundred pc central help and uniform toll free quantity 1962, and likewise made numerous options to enhance the current veterinary providers for the consideration of the division. The minister assured the committee that the division would guarantee to take applicable motion on the options given by the members.
